Oscillating meter

A vibrator is an instrument that directly indicates the peak, peak-to-peak, average, or rms value of vibrations such as displacement, velocity, acceleration, and acceleration derivatives. The main parts of this instrument are, integral differential circuits, amplifiers, voltage detectors and heads. The integral differential circuit is used to complete the above-mentioned vibration between the integral and differential operation, generally can be used integral, differential operational amplifier, can also be used low-pass filter, high-pass filter to complete the integral and differential operation. However, the use of this instrument should be calculated when they pay attention to their application frequency range. The vibrator can only give people the total strength (vibration level) of the vibration, and can not obtain other information, and therefore use a limited range.
